The original UK version has been accused of being a 'Friends' knock-off but other than it being about three men and three women who are living the single life in the city, they're pretty different. If you strain really hard, you can sort of map characters from 'Friends' onto those from 'Coupling' but it's a pretty loose fit. At best, the inspiration to do a series about a coupe of young single friends in the city might have comes from 'Friends' but it's hardly an original concept.
The biggest difference is in how narratives are told, with 'Coupling' willing to do things like split screen episodes and an episode where the same events are shown from two different character's point of view. The storytelling in 'Friends' was much more straightforward.
The US version tried to repeat the process that 'The Office' followed when coming to the US, using the UK scripts mostly unaltered for early episodes. That was so poorly implemented that the show was yanked off the air after only four episodes. The reception was so negative that the network didn't even use the left over episodes as summer time filler.
